Tanzania Peaberry

Roast: Dark 

 

Notes: Dark milk chocolate, Spices, Dark brown sugar, and Fruit.  

Grown on the southern slopes of Mount Kilimanjaro, this
estate has the ideal growing conditions for exceptional
coffees. With volcanic soil, indigenous shade trees and
glacier-fed rivers Mount Kilimanjaro Plantation thrives.


Mount Kilimanjaro focuses on the health of their coffees and
their community. MKE ensures that they can offer medical
care, insurance, retirement plans for long-term employees,
HIV training and testing, scholarships for local schools, and
large investments in community projects. Mount
Kilimanjaro strives to harmonize coffee quality, people, and
the environment. As a large coffee estate in Tanzania,
Kilimanjaro Plantation is aware of its environmental
responsibility and has set standards that meet the
requirements of UTZ certification. MKE is continuously and
conscientiously reviewing these standards.


This washed coffee is grown at 2,000 - 2,500 meters above
sea level and is made up of KP, N39 and Batian varietals.

** Freshness **

Whole bean coffee normally maintains its freshness for about two months.  Ground coffee usually is best if used within two to three weeks.
